Study Overview
Brief Summary
This randomized controlled study will evaluate the effectiveness of an online Watch-Summarize-Question-Ask (WSQA) learning method on nursing students' knowledge, skills, attitudes, and behaviors related to patient fall prevention and management. Sixty-six nursing students will be randomly assigned to intervention and control groups. Both groups will receive standard patient safety education, while the intervention group will additionally participate in an online, evidence-based fall prevention training program structured according to the WSQA method, including video-based learning, summarization, question generation, and interactive discussions. Outcomes will be assessed using validated instruments measuring fall management knowledge, self-efficacy, attitudes toward fall prevention, care planning performance, and student satisfaction. The study aims to determine the effectiveness of an innovative educational approach to improve fall prevention competencies and enhance the quality and safety of nursing care.
Detailed Description
Objective The aim of this study is to evaluate the effect of an online fall prevention training program, developed based on the Watch-Summarize-Question-Ask instructional strategy, on the knowledge, skills, attitudes, and behaviors of fourth-year undergraduate nursing students. This evaluation will be conducted using the four levels of the Kirkpatrick's Four-Level Evaluation Model, and it aims to comprehensively determine both the learning outcomes of the training and its reflection on clinical practice.
Type of Research This research will be conducted using a randomized controlled experimental design. Participants will be randomly assigned to two groups using the block randomization method.
Location and Time of the Study The study will be conducted at the Faculty of Nursing, İnönü University, between February and June 2026.
Participants/Sample The study population will consist of fourth-year undergraduate nursing participants enrolled in the Nursing Internship Course at the Faculty of Nursing, İnönü University, during the 2025-2026 academic year. Power analysis indicated a minimum sample size of 56 participants; however, considering potential attrition, a total of 66 participants will be recruited. Participants who meet the inclusion criteria will be assigned to the experimental and control groups using a block randomization method. Each group will include 33 participants (Experimental Group = 33; Control Group = 33).
Method / Intervention Participants in both groups will receive the standard patient safety education included in the undergraduate nursing curriculum. In addition, participants in the experimental group will receive an evidence-based fall prevention training delivered through an online learning model structured according to the Watch-Summarize-Question (WSQ) teaching strategy. The intervention will include video-based learning, structured summarization activities, question generation, and interactive online discussion sessions to reinforce learning and promote active participation. The control group will continue with the standard curriculum without receiving the WSQ-based training. Outcomes will be evaluated using validated measurement tools assessing knowledge, skills, attitudes, and behavioral outcomes related to fall management.

Arms & Interventions
Experimental Group
Participants in the experimental arm will receive the standard patient safety education included in the undergraduate nursing curriculum through face-to-face instruction. In addition, they will participate in the Watch-Summarize-Question (WSQ)-based online fall prevention education. The WSQ program will include watching educational videos, summarizing course content, generating questions, participating in interactive online discussion sessions, and engaging in peer interaction through an online discussion forum.
Intervention: Online Watch Summarize Question Learning Model (Behavioral)
Control Group
Participants in the control arm will receive only the standard patient safety education included in the undergraduate nursing curriculum through face-to-face instruction and will not receive any additional educational intervention during the study period.

Satisfaction with E-Learning Scale (Turkish version: E-Derslere Yönelik Memnuniyet Ölçeği)
Time Frame: Immediately after completion of the intervention
The scale developed by Kolburan Geçer and Deveci Topal aims to determine university students' satisfaction levels with the online courses they attend. The Cronbach's alpha reliability coefficient of the scale was calculated as 0.97. The scale consists of 35 items and 5 subdimensions. The response options are designed as a five-point Likert-type scale scored between 1 and 5.
Falls Management Knowledge Test
Time Frame: At baseline and immediately after completion of the education program and at least 3 weeks after the training
This test will be developed by the researcher based on a literature review to assess participants' knowledge levels on falls management and to evaluate the effectiveness of the education on the patient safety knowledge subdimension
Scales for Assessing Self-Efficacy
Time Frame: At baseline and immediately after completion of the education program and at least 3 weeks after the training
The Cronbach's Alpha value of the scale developed by Dykes and colleagues and validated in Turkish by Ekin and Uğur was found to be 0.97, and it has no subscales. The scale consists of 11 items prepared on a 6-point Likert scale. In the evaluation of the scale, the item mean of the scores obtained from all items is used, and as the scores increase, the level of self-efficacy also increases.
Attitudes of Nurses Toward Falls Prevention Scale (Turkish version: Hemşirelerin Düşmelerin Önlenmesine Yönelik Tutumları Ölçeği)
Time Frame: At baseline and immediately after completion of the education program and at least 3 weeks after the training.
The Cronbach's Alpha reliability coefficient of the scale developed by Özbudak and Koç in 2023 was found to be 0.84. The scale consists of 19 items and 5 sub-dimensions. The scale's response options are designed as a five-point Likert scale scored on a 1-5 point range. The scale is evaluated based on the mean score.
Care Plan Evaluation Form
Time Frame: At baseline and at least 3 weeks after the training
A structured seven-item assessment form developed by the researchers will be used to determine the extent to which students reflect their knowledge and awareness of fall management in their care plans.
